文档

持有

添加新地块时保留当前地块

语法

抓住
推迟
保存所有
持有
(ax,___

描述

例子

抓住保留当前轴中的图,以便添加到轴中的新图不会删除现有的图。的基础上,新绘图使用下一种颜色和线条样式ColorOrder而且LineStyleOrder坐标轴的性质。MATLAB®调整轴限制、标记和标记标签,以显示全部范围的数据。如果轴不存在,则持有命令创建它们。

例子

推迟将保持状态设置为关闭,以便添加到轴上的新图清除现有的图并重置所有轴属性。添加到坐标轴的下一个图形使用基于的第一个颜色和线条样式ColorOrder而且LineStyleOrder坐标轴的性质。此选项是默认行为。

保存所有抓住.该语法将在未来的版本中删除。使用抓住代替。

持有在打开和关闭之间切换保持状态。

例子

持有(斧头___属性所指定的轴的保持状态斧头而不是现在的坐标轴。将轴指定为前面任何语法的第一个输入参数。的前后使用单引号“上”而且“关闭”输入,例如(ax,“上”)

例子

全部折叠

创建一个线形图。使用抓住在不删除现有线形图的情况下添加第二个线形图。新绘图使用下一个颜色和线条样式的基础上ColorOrder而且LineStyleOrder坐标轴的性质。然后将保持状态重置为关闭。

X = linspace(-pi,pi);Y1 = sinx;情节(x, y₁)Y2 = cosx;情节(x, y2)

当保持状态为off时,新的plot删除现有的plot。新图从颜色顺序和线条样式顺序开始。

Y3 = sin(2*x);情节(x, y3)

创建带有两个子图的图形,并分配变量的对象ax₁而且ax2.在每个子图中添加一个线状图。然后在上面的子图中添加第二行图。

Ax1 = subplot(2,1,1);X = linspace(0,10);Y1 = sinx;Plot (ax1,x,y1) ax2 = subplot(2,1,2);Y2 = cosx;情节(ax2 x, y2)

持有(ax₁“上”) y3 = sin(2*x);情节(ax₁,x, y3)持有(ax₁,“关闭”

输入参数

全部折叠

目标轴,指定为对象或PolarAxes对象。如果不指定坐标轴,那么持有设置当前轴的保持状态。

提示

  • 使用ishold函数测试保持状态。

算法

持有函数设置NextPlot的属性PolarAxes反对任何一个“添加”“替换”

R2006a之前介绍

这个话题有用吗?